This notation strips away the rigid syntax requirements of code, allowing developers and engineers to focus purely on the sequence of operations, conditions, and data transformations required to solve a problem. By providing a high-level, readable description, it enables teams to communicate complex logic efficiently without getting bogged down in language-specific nuances, making it an indispensable tool during the design and planning phases of software development.
